A motorboat travels 432 kilometers on 6 hours going upstream and 384 km in 4 hours going downstream. What is the rate of the boa
antiseptic1488 [7]
Going upstream: 432 km / 6 hours = 72 km/h
Going downstream: 384 km / 4 hours = 96 km/h
Going upstream against the current means that the effective speed is:
r_boat - r_current = 72
Meanwhile, going downstream with the current means;
r_boat + r_current = 96
Adding both equations (to cancel out r_current) gives:
2r_boat = 72 + 96
r_boat = 84 km/h
Substituting back into one of the original equations: r_current = 12 km/h.

Find the measure of the indicated angle.
marusya05 [52]

Answer:

the answer is 96°

Step-by-step explanation:

it is an isosceles triangle as it's 2 sides are equal.

for an isosceles triangle, the angles made by the equal sides with the third side are equal.

and the sum of all angles in a triangle = 180°

42 + 42 + x = 180

x = 180 - 84

X = 96°
